(Kenya)— [Lifesitenews.com] Kenyan medical authorities have banned Marie Stopes, the international abortion provider, from offering any kind of abortion services. (Photo: Creative Commons -Pixabay)

Judging from the US and UK press reports about this decision it looked as if this was a move that was as wholly arbitrary as it was unexpected. Of course, this was not the case.

In September 2018, Marie Stopes was instructed to desist from promoting its services via Kenyan radio networks. The advertisements being run were seen by many as "drumming up" business for abortion with a direct appeal to teenage girls.

The advertisements were not only judged to be offensive in terms of taste in this deeply Christian country, but for some they also appeared to be undermining existing Kenyan law on abortion, which only permits abortion in the case of a threat to the life of the mother. Advertising for abortion is not permitted under Kenyan law and is also prohibited under local medical practitioner rules.

So the breaching of the broadcast rules by Marie Stopes in September 2018 initiated an inquiry from Kenyan medical authorities. This resulted in a letter being sent on November 14, 2018 from the Kenyan Medical Practitioners Board to Marie Stopes stating that: "Marie Stopes Kenya is hereby directed to immediately cease and desist offering any form of abortion services in all its facilities within the republic."
